[0015] In order to deepen the understanding of the present invention, the present invention will be described in further detail below with reference to the embodiments. The embodiments are only used to explain the present invention and do not constitute a limitation on the protection scope of the present invention.

[0016] The present embodiment provides a 2-methyl-5-nitroimidazole related substance detection method, comprising the following steps:

[0017] Step 1: Take the test solution, accurately weigh 60.0mg of the sample, transfer it into a 100ml volumetric flask, dissolve it with the mobile phase solution and dilute to the mark;

Abstract

A detection method for 2-methyl-5-nitroimidazole related substances is disclosed. The method includes adding a blank mobile phase solution, a standard substance solution and a solution of a product tobe detected into automatic sample injectors respectively, injecting 10 [mu]L of each of the solutions into a liquid chromatograph, and calculating the single-impurity content and the total impurity content of the product to be detected through a normalization manner to obtain a detection result. The detection precision is higher, and the method is simple to operate, low in cost and wider in application range.

technical field [0001] The invention relates to the technical field of detection, in particular to a detection method for 2-methyl-5-nitroimidazole related substances. Background technique [0002] 2-Methyl-5-nitroimidazole is mainly used in organic synthesis in industry, and it is an important intermediate for the synthesis of pharmaceutical raw materials metronidazole, secnidazole, and veterinary drug dalmesu, and 2-methylimidazole is mostly used in industry. As raw material, in the concentrated sulfuric acid medium, dropwise concentrated nitric acid at high temperature and carry out nitration reaction to obtain, the prior art is relatively low in the detection efficiency of 2-methyl-5-nitroimidazole related substances, and its detection accuracy is not high, therefore , it is very important to solve this kind of problem.
